Output c61a31a71038bcf91891e47be6e263db3e21cb8729ee15e40607352e88e0ad4a:8

value
1395762
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f354d5398cdaf817f036271f37e9d97d7402a243 OP_EQUAL
address
3PsdkTCD7w9SxNnxsT2uUdzZksSrpc2xof
transaction
c61a31a71038bcf91891e47be6e263db3e21cb8729ee15e40607352e88e0ad4a
spent
true